Description | Circular shell gorget with notched edge suspened throuh two holes at the center on a piece of rawhide. Large milk-white glass beads. Gotget has design incised: five shapes (three on the bottom, two in row above separated by a cross). Shapes may represent horse tracks. Back of gorget (where it would rub the neck) shows considrable wear. |
